NEWS
SOLVED Error: spawn udevadm ENOENT Zigbee Adapter
-
ich habe das selbe Problem. Habe mir diesen USB Stick bestellt und bei mir läuft iobroker im Docker auf der Diskstation DS2016+II
bekomme den Stick nicht zum laufen, habe im Log folgende Fehlermeldungen
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:Lösung:
Die Console des Containers öffnen
apt-get update
apt-get -y install udev
Danach den Container neu startet und die Meldung ist weg. Gib Bescheid ob es was gebracht hat.auch dies habe ich probiert, leider ergebnislos !
die Infos zu iobroker
Plattform: linux Die Architektur: x64 CPUs: 2 Geschwindigkeit: 1601 MHz Modell: Intel(R) Celeron(R) CPU N3060 @ 1.60GHz RAM: 7.7 GB System uptime: 44 T. 00:47:23 Node.js: v8.15.0 Adapter zählen: 226 NPM: v6.4.1 Uptime: 00:13:55
-
Hast du das mal porbiert:
apt-get update
apt-get -y install udev
Danach neu starten -
Du hast auch nen völlig anderen Fehler. Der findet deinen Stick überhaupt nicht.
- Wird der Stick an der Synologie erkannt?
- Hast du den Stick an den Container übergeben?
- Sicher das der Pfad zum Stick richtig ist?
- Welche Version ist auf dem Stickk geflashed?
-
@duffbeer2000
sorry wenn ich dazu gegen fragen stellen muss!- woran sehe ich ob der an der DS erkannt wird?
- wie übergebe ich den Stick an den Container
- Wie finde ich den richtigen Pfad heraus
- Wie sehe ich welche Version auf dem Stick geflasht wurde auf Win10 zb.
wenn ich unter /dev/ mit ls -la nachsehe und der stick ist angesteckt sehe ich ihn unter ttyACM0 , wenn er ausgesteckt ist gibt es diesen Pfad nicht, nehme an das dies der Pfad ist?!
-
Das sieht schonmal gut aus, jetzt musst du dem Container das Device beim start mitgeben mitgeben: --device=/dev/ttyACM0
Und den Container priviligiert starten --privilegedKannst du im Webinterface des Zigbee Adapters das richtige Gerät schon per Dropdown auswählen oder hast du das reingeschrieben? Bei mir lief es erst als ich es per Dropdown auswählen konnte.
Hast du dir nur den Stick gekauft oder speziell schon mit geflashter Firmware? -
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:
jetzt musst du dem Container das Device beim start mitgeben mitgeben
wo mach ich das ?
wäre es hier richtig
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:
Und den Container priviligiert starten --privileged
so ?
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:
Kannst du im Webinterface des Zigbee Adapters das richtige Gerät schon per Dropdown auswählen oder hast du das reingeschrieben? Bei mir lief es erst als ich es per Dropdown auswählen konnte.
ich habe es reingeschrieben, dennoch habe ich ein dropdown
den Stick habe ich geflasht gekauft , https://www.ebay.de/itm/USB-CC2531-Stick-Zigbee-iobroker-FHEM-Openhab-zigbee2mqtt-Xiaomi-IKEA-Hue/173660821485?ssPageName=STRK%3AMEBIDX%3AIT&_trksid=p2057872.m2749.l2649
-
hat hier niemand eine Antwort, langsam verzweifle ich, seit Stunden probier ich und suche mir die Finger wund im Internet und komme nicht weiter !
-
Ich hab leider keine eigene Synology aber was ich an den Screenshots sehen kann:
- privileged hast du korrekt asugewählt über die "hohe Priorität"
Das mit dem Volume ist falsch, kannst du mir vielleicht mal einen Screenshot der Seite Links und Umwelt schicken? Ich will rausfinden ob da vielleicht was ist um den Stick korrekt zu übergeben.
-
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:
Seite Links und Umwelt
wenn du mir sagts was das sein soll, ja !
-
Moment mal, theroetisch müssten die erhöhten Rechte ausreichen. Jetzt versuch mal folgendes. Geh in den Zigbee Adapter über das Webinterface und dort in die Einstellungen. Dann wähle Reset und mach einen Hard reset. Danach sollte der Adapter auf Werkseinstellungen sein. Falls danach noch ein Gerät drin steht dann lösch es raus und wähle es danach über das Dropdown Menü aus. Speichern und schließen und dann das Ergebnis mitteilen.
-
wird leider wieder gelb !
nachdem ich das device angegeben habe und speichere kommt folgendes:
-
Und was kommt nach den 60s? Hab dir eine PN geschrieben.
-
mein Problem ist dank @duffbeer2000 der sich per teamviewer zu mir verbunden hatte gelöst!!! DANKE!
-
Was war die Lösung?
-
Der ursprüngliche Fehler war das die erhöhten Rechte gefehlt haben. Der zweite Fehler der beim Lösungsversuch entstand war das der Serielle Anschluß /dev/ttyACM0 als Ordner eingebunden war. Somit hatte der Adapter keinen Zugriff mehr drauf. Somit erst Container stoppen, Ordner binding entfernen, starten, Adapter hard reset, Stick auswählen, speichern und es tut.
-
gibt es für diese FM "error: spawn udevadm ENOENT" jetzt schon eine Lösung ?
-
Hast du das mal porbiert:
apt-get update
apt-get -y install udev
Danach neu starten -
- das mach ich auf der iobroker Konsole
2. was ist dieses udev?--> hab ich gerade in wiki nachglesen - wenn ich das ausführe macht mir das eh nicht noch mehr schaden ?
- was neustarten , den Adapter also Zigbee
- das mach ich auf der iobroker Konsole
-
so und nun Neustart vom Zigbee Adapter, oder iobroker?
-
@duffbeer2000 sagte in Error: spawn udevadm ENOENT Zigbee Adapter:
Hast du das mal porbiert:
apt-get update
apt-get -y install udev
Danach neu startendie Fehlermeldung "spawn udevadm ENOENT" ist weg, dank dir !
-
Neustart von Linux. War gestern nicht mehr am PC deshalb die verspätete Antwort.